2004–05 George Mason Patriots Men's Basketball Team

Season notes

* On June 3, 2005, the team hired James Johnson and promoted Chris Caputo to assistant coaches. * The 2004–05 George Mason Patriots were predicted to finish 3rd in the Colonial Athletic Association.
